Running with lights on during daytime is pretty normal nowadays. It has been proven since the 80's to reduce accidents and increase visibility. Makes me wonder why it's taking so long for us to catch up on this. Sweden, Canada, and most of the U.S. require this already either via the standard headlamps or high intensity amber markers.
Shell, Victory Liner, and other companies actually require their drivers to drive with the headlamps on whatever time of the day it is.
Private car owners even shell out tons of cash (around Php10k) for fancy LED daytime running light kits. The regular lights work fine for me.
But still, not an excuse to drive with no license plates since the law requires such.
